Hundreds of Berbers in Morocco have marched in front of the National Assembly in Rabat protesting the death of a student killed during clashes between Amazigh students and those from the Western Sahara.
Omar Khalek passed away a few days later after he was assaulted by students supporting the Polisario front.
According to his friends, he was a staunch supporter of Amazigh’s integrity.
Morocco occupies Western Sahara but the Polisario front is bent on establishing an independent Sahrawi Arab Republic.
Protesters brandished slogans and flags to protest Omar’s death.
“This protest has been organised in front of Morocco’s parliament to condemn the political assassination of
Omar Khaleq,” Mounie Kejji, an Amazigh militant told AFP.
His close friends described him as a respectful and highly educated person but equally shy.
